The New England Institute of Art Library, located in the Student Center Building at Center Campus, provides students, faculty, and staff with a welcoming and comfortable facility for research, study, and learning. The library offers its users a full array of resources oriented towards the creative, professional and academic programs offered at The New England Institute of Art.
All disciplines in the college curriculum are supported by the library's collection of books, periodicals, DVDs, videos, music CDs, CD-ROMs, DVD-ROMs, Software CD-ROMs, Sound Effects CD-ROMs, CD-ROM games, e-Books, and online database subscriptions. In addition, there are twenty computers and two listening and viewing stations for student use. Library resources may be searched online from the library website at http://lib411.aisites.com/. Many of the online databases have remote access capabilities allowing them to be fully searched from students’ homes and off-campus locations.
Library staff members are available to assist students with their information and research needs. Services include reference and research assistance, library instruction, interlibrary loans, and a reserve collection of required course materials. Library instruction sessions introduce students to effective research methods and to the vast resource options available to them. Interlibrary loans are available through the MetroWest Massachusetts Regional Library System and with walk-in borrowing privileges at the 15 academic institutions of the neighboring Fenway Library Consortium.
During the academic year, the Library is open 66 hours a week, Monday through Saturday, to serve the information needs of the college community. The Library Reading Room is open all hours on the same schedule as the Center Campus building.
